Sep 27, 2022 · The Charles Daly 101 is a single shot, folding shotgun made in Turkey and distributed by Chiappa. They’re based on the older Beretta FS-1/412. They use extractors (no ejectors) and have interchangeable chokes. They come with a variety of barrel lengths and come in 410, 20 gauge and 12 gauge. They’re also super cheap. I […]

The newer CD labeled guns were and are made in Turkey by Akkar that have very bad quality control, especially with the metal in the locking blocks of the pumps and semi autos. These parts were made of inferior cast metal and have been known to crack and break.Charles Daly went out of buisness last month or so. The Mirokus they imported are the older version of the current Citoris sold by Browning, good gun but they are obsolete and parts are now scarce. C.D. also imported guns from Italy and Turkey.The Italian guns are hit and miss , mostly good but avoid the Turkish guns.CDNN still carries the ...

Charles Daly has been a firearms importer for the last 150 years. It has been bought, sold, bankrupted, resurrected a number of times. They were the importers for Miroku O/U shotguns for several years, as well as numerous other ...It just means you’re getting a lot of quality for very little money. Miroku made Charles Daly’s shotguns from 1967 to 1976, and the one you see here cost around $150 in 1968. The Model 500 was made on the classic Anson & Deeley action. Available in 12 gauge, 20 gauge and 410, the Daly show sports a 14″ barrel for an overall length of 27″, avoiding NFA status in a wieldy if not perfectly shoulderable package. The Honcho has a couple of major rivals: Remington’s Tac14 and the Mossberg Shockwave. Charles Daly doesn't make any guns at all. Never did. It is (always has been) a brand that is applied to imported guns. A hundred years ago Charles Daly guns were as good as any in the world, but in recent years their quality has ranged from OK to garbage, depending on who made them.

Si prega di utilizzare il modulo per accedere al gestionale. LOGIN. melissa o'neil height History. Charles Daly was born in New York City on October 12, 1839. Around 1875 in New York City, Charles Daly and August Schoverling began importing firearms into the United States, primarily from the city of Suhl in what was then Prussia. Manufacturers for Daly at that time included Heym, Shiller, H. A.
